Have you participated in hospital committee meetings and contributed to policy and procedure development?
Sample answer to the question:
Yes, I have participated in hospital committee meetings and contributed to policy and procedure development. In my previous role as a Senior Neurosurgeon, I served on the Hospital Quality Improvement Committee where we reviewed and revised existing policies and procedures related to neurosurgery. I actively shared my expertise and insights during these meetings, contributing to the development of updated protocols that improved patient safety and surgical outcomes. Additionally, I was involved in the creation of a new policy for postoperative pain management, which incorporated the latest research and best practices in the field. My contributions to these committee meetings allowed me to collaborate with other healthcare professionals and make a positive impact on the quality of care provided at the hospital.
Here is a more solid answer:
Yes, I have actively participated in hospital committee meetings and played a leadership role in policy and procedure development. As a Senior Neurosurgeon, I was appointed as the Chair of the Hospital Quality Improvement Committee, where I led discussions and facilitated the review and revision of neurosurgical protocols. I initiated the implementation of a comprehensive surgical checklist that significantly reduced the occurrence of preventable surgical errors. Additionally, I collaborated closely with other healthcare professionals, including nurses, anesthesiologists, and radiologists, to ensure a multidisciplinary approach to policy development. This collaborative effort resulted in the creation of streamlined protocols that enhanced patient safety and improved surgical outcomes. My leadership and collaboration skills were instrumental in driving positive change within the hospital.
Why is this a more solid answer?
The solid answer provides more specific details about the candidate's leadership role as the Chair of the Hospital Quality Improvement Committee and their initiative to implement a surgical checklist. It also highlights their collaboration with other healthcare professionals and the positive outcomes of their contributions. However, it could provide more examples of their knowledge of policies and procedures.
An example of a exceptional answer:
Yes, I have actively participated in hospital committee meetings and made significant contributions to policy and procedure development throughout my career as a Neurosurgeon. In my previous role, I not only chaired the Hospital Quality Improvement Committee but also served as a key member of the Policy Development Committee. Through my leadership, we successfully implemented evidence-based policies for infection control in neurosurgical procedures, resulting in a substantial reduction in surgical site infections. Furthermore, I spearheaded the development of a comprehensive informed consent process that ensured patients fully understood the risks and benefits of their procedures. This process involved collaborating with hospital administration, legal teams, and patient advocacy groups to develop a patient-centered approach. These initiatives were recognized by the hospital accreditation board and resulted in improved patient satisfaction and compliance with regulatory standards. My extensive knowledge of policies and procedures, coupled with my ability to lead and collaborate, have consistently driven positive changes in the hospital's operations.
Why is this an exceptional answer?
The exceptional answer includes specific details about the candidate's involvement in policy and procedure development as a key member of the Policy Development Committee. It also highlights their accomplishments in implementing evidence-based policies and developing a patient-centered informed consent process. Additionally, it mentions the recognition received for their initiatives and the positive impact on patient satisfaction and regulatory compliance. The answer demonstrates the candidate's exceptional knowledge of policies and procedures, strong leadership skills, and effective collaboration with various stakeholders.
How to prepare for this question:
  • Familiarize yourself with the policies and procedures commonly found in hospitals, especially those related to neurosurgical procedures.
  • Highlight any previous experience or involvement in hospital committees or working groups during interviews or on your resume.
  • Be prepared to provide specific examples of your contributions to policy and procedure development, including any positive outcomes or improvements resulting from your involvement.
  • Demonstrate your ability to collaborate with healthcare professionals from different disciplines and emphasize the importance of a multidisciplinary approach.
  • Stay up to date with the latest research and advancements in neurosurgery to showcase your commitment to continued education and staying informed.
What are interviewers evaluating with this question?
  • Leadership
  • Collaboration
  • Knowledge of Policies and Procedures
